The accomodation was clean and satisfactory-quite spacious! Kitchen was well equipped (apart from a pair of scissors) but the electric cooker a little slow.
The bathroom was fine, bath with overhead shower, a shower curtain (quite a novelty after the Greek Islands), a WC, bidet and large wash-basin.
The pool is treated every night from 9pm onwards, and is open until then.
There are supermarkets 5-10 minutes walk away. (Out of main entrance, turn left, walk to roundabout, turn right, at next crossroads turn left and past the "Topiaza" snack bar (and Pub) you will find Alisuper the "supermarcado"
A walk into town is about 20 minutes-about 25 to the marina. There's a shuttle bus available too, from reception almost every half hour.
for a family of four it is probably cheaper to get a taxi...we usually walked in and then taxid back-fro less than 5 Euros!
We visited Aqualand which is near "Albufeira" - their coach stops at the Nautilus daily there and back! Take your sunblock!!
The 4 of us did a "sunset cruise"a 2 hour boatride total cost with 2 adults and 2 kids was about 27 euros.
Don't miss the Roman Ruin near the Marina. I'm no history type but they amazed me and my 8 year old is still excited about having seen them. There are amazing examples of preserved mosaic floors and the varios parts of the villa are incredible! Entry there is cheap too-we paid 2 Euros-for all of us. They give you an English map and there are info boards all the way round. At the end a small museum with some of the artifacts and SKELETONS unearthed there!
Do NOT miss the marina and the shops and snack bars there...and gorgeous ice creams!
Back at the Nautilus more kids arrived over the 2 weeks we were there and days around the pool livened up. However, at night time the bar called last orders at about 11pm ish (serves food till 10pm) and by 1130pm all is peaceful and quiet!
Another thing about the bar: It serves the best Chicken Piri Piri in Vilamoura! And that's a fact!
Would I go back? Absolutely. I might pack a dishcloth this time and a pair of scissors but that's all.
